Output 960de586cf7a7e5adb9b43fb7a19a39fcce6ef3b34def4e047dc31c19f888019:1

value
20862
script pubkey
OP_0 OP_PUSHBYTES_20 6d0e3c3746813f57916902ace48cde0f31f74575
address
bc1qd58rcd6xsyl40ytfq2kwfrx7puclw3t4jmh35s
transaction
960de586cf7a7e5adb9b43fb7a19a39fcce6ef3b34def4e047dc31c19f888019
confirmations
36081
spent
true